Shinsegae to Begin Construction of 'Starfield Changwon' in December ... Passes Gyeongnam Province Building Review
[Asia Economy Yeongnam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Lee Sang-hyun] Changwon City, Gyeongnam Province, announced on the 20th that 'Starfield Changwon' has passed the architectural review by the Gyeongsangnam-do Architectural Committee.
The architectural review application involves a site of 34,339㎡ in Jung-dong, Uichang-gu, with plans for a cultural complex space including sales facilities, a cinema, and sports facilities, consisting of 7 basement floors and 5 above-ground floors, with a total area of 242,380㎡.
Starfield Changwon Co., Ltd. stated that they plan to obtain the building permit within 2021 and commence construction thereafter, aiming for completion in January 2025.
